LNOC Congratulates Kirsty Coventry On Her Election As IOC President

The Liberia National Olympic Committee (LNOC) has extended its heartfelt congratulations to Kirsty Coventry on her historic election as the new President of the International Olympic Committee (IOC). “As a decorated former Zimbabwean swimmer and two-time Olympic gold medalist, Coventry’s remarkable leadership, dedication to sports development, and commitment to the Olympic Movement have been widely recognized,” a LNOC press release noted.

According to the release, “Winning in the first round of voting is a testament to her vision and the trust placed in her by the global sporting community. The LNOC is confident that under her leadership, the IOC will continue to uphold the values of excellence, unity, and inclusivity in sports.

“Kirsty Coventry’s journey from an elite athlete to a respected global sports administrator is truly inspiring. As Africa’s first female IOC President, her election marks a significant milestone for the continent and the world of sports.

The LNOC release added that, with her vast experience as an Olympian, former Minister of Sports in Zimbabwe, and IOC member, she is well-positioned to drive meaningful progress and innovation within the Olympic Movement.

“The LNOC looks forward to working closely with President Coventry in advancing the Olympic spirit and fostering opportunities for athletes worldwide. We wish her great success in this new and prestigious role,” the Liberia National Olympic Committee, headed by Cllr. Sylvester Rennie, observed.
